Okay, so I have my first show this Friday! YAY! Anyway, I keep hearing about this "booking slide" and am wondering what that is! Can someone please explain? Thanks. Also, what are some good games to play? I know about the one where you have a product and people pass it every time you say a certain word. I think that was the one in the cooking show dvd. But I would love ideas! I'm so nervous. Then my grand opening is Feb. 7th, then a show the 21st and then one beg. of March. But I would really like to get more booked, so I'm hoping I can get some bookings on Friday. Please help! Thanks.

Also, do a search and type in "games" and you should also come up with some great threads where people have shared ideas.For your first show, I would stick to doing something like what you see in the training DVD. If you are able to print off the booking slide in time, I would use it. It is a great tool to help you get their attention and also have a visual to help you remember to cover all the details about the host benefits. Good luck! It's so exciting, isn't it?! :)
 
First I'd like to say CONGRATULATIONS!!!! My director actually gave each of us at the last cluster meeting a booking slide that she had laminated I folded like an accordian. It makes for a great visual effect & like Amanda said...it helps you to remember all the key points of hosting & the opportunity.

I found that the "Queen of the Shoppers" game (found here under files) has gone over well with my customers...& gets them looking through the catalog at all the products you're talking about.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a Booking Slide in Pampered Chef parties?

A Booking Slide is a visual aid used during Pampered Chef parties to encourage guests to consider hosting their own party. It typically highlights the benefits of hosting, such as earning free products, exclusive discounts, and fun experiences.

How can I effectively use the Booking Slide during my presentation?

To effectively use the Booking Slide, present it at a strategic point in your party, usually after demonstrating a few products. Engage your guests by sharing personal stories about successful parties and the rewards you've received. Make sure to ask open-ended questions to spark interest.

What types of games can I incorporate to encourage bookings?

You can incorporate various games such as a "Booking Bingo" where guests mark off squares related to hosting, or a "Spin the Wheel" game where they can win prizes for booking a party. These interactive elements can make the idea of hosting more appealing and fun.

How do I follow up with guests after the party regarding bookings?

After the party, follow up with guests through personalized messages or emails. Thank them for attending and remind them of the benefits discussed during the party. Offer to answer any questions they may have about hosting and suggest a few dates to make it easier for them to commit.

What should I do if a guest shows interest but is hesitant to book a party?

If a guest shows interest but is hesitant, listen to their concerns and address them directly. Provide reassurance about the process and emphasize the support you will offer. You can also offer flexible options, such as virtual parties or smaller gatherings, to make hosting more manageable for them.
